What is a Small Cot?
A small cot, often described as a compact bed or baby cot, is designed to optimize sleeping space while minimizing its overall footprint. These beds are available in various sizes, normally ranging from toddler beds to smaller twin beds. They are ideal for small bed rooms, short-lived visitor sleeping arrangements, and even as part of a minimalist way of life.

What age is a small cot beds cot suitable for?
Small cots can be ideal for different age, from babies (in baby cots) to children and grownups (in smaller sized twin beds). Constantly refer to the maker's standards for age recommendations.
2. Are little cots safe for babies?
Yes, as long as they meet current safety standards. Try to find cots that have been checked and accredited for safety, particularly if you are purchasing a baby cot or toddler bed.
3. Can little cots accommodate adult weight?
Some small cots, like twin cots and particular folding alternatives, are created to support adult weight. Constantly inspect the manufacturer's specifications for weight limits.
4. How do I pick the right bed mattress for a small cot?
Select a mattress that fits snugly within the cot's frame with no spaces. Guarantee it is comfortable and supportive. For baby cots to tots, consider a firm bed mattress as suggested by pediatricians.
5. Do little cots come with storage choices?
Many little cots, particularly loft beds and some young child beds, included integrated storage or the alternative to include under-bed storage. This is beneficial for taking full advantage of area in smaller bedrooms.
